Meghan Linsey Releases New EP ‘Believer’ July 31

Meghan Linsey 2015The Voice runner-up and former Steel Magnolia member Meghan Linsey is releasing a new EP, Believer, July 31. The collection was produced by Tyler Cain and recorded in Nashville, and features six songs co-written by Linsey that highlight her soulful, swampy sound.

The EP will be available exclusively in an early release on Ghost Tunes at a reduced price beginning July 27, and will be released to all digital retailers four days later.

“Recording this time around was really just about finding my voice as a solo artist, and for me, that meant getting back to my roots,” Linsey says about the new project. “I grew up in New Orleans and I’ve always had a soulful sound, I’m just now really able to showcase it fully. Tyler Cain produced the record and we did a lot of it with a total of three musicians. I think keeping it small was key. His production really allows me to showcase my soulful side while keeping it mainstream. These six songs are a great representation of me, as a human and an artist. They’re bold and genuine and have depth. I really laid it all out there.”

Believer Track Listing:
“Counterfeit”
“Believer”
“Sunshine In My Soul”
“This Side of Heaven”
“Everything is Happening”
“Best of Me”
